Exploring Government Security Guard Job Opportunities
Seeking a career path that blends public service with protective responsibilities? Look into government security guard job opportunities, which offer a challenging and meaningful role in protecting vital assets. These positions present the opportunity to contribute your nation while enhancing valuable expertise.
Government security guards work in a diverse range of settings, including local agencies, government facilities, and strategic sites. The specific duties can fluctuate depending on the agency but often include tasks such as patrolling premises, conducting security checks, addressing to incidents, and upholding order.
- To become a government security guard, you typically require a secondary school certificate.
- Additional requirements may include background checks, drug screenings, and physical fitness tests.
- Advanced training programs are often available to enhance your skills in areas such as emergency response.
Exploring the Government Security Guard Salary Range
The compensation for government security guards can range considerably depending on a multitude of factors. These factors include location, level of experience, specific duties and responsibilities, and the employing agency's budget constraints.
In some metropolitan centers, government security guards may earn better compensation due to a higher necessity of security personnel. Conversely, areas with lower population densities may offer commensurate but potentially less generous compensation.
Those just starting out typically receive an initial wage, while experienced and specialized security guards can command more substantial salaries.
To obtain a clearer picture more info of government security guard salaries in your specific region, it is recommended to research departmental salary information or contact relevant human resource departments.
